Summary
- Dr. Geoffrey Cho is a board-certified cardiologist on faculty at the David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A. He is board certified multiple disciplines, including cardiology, cardiac CT, nuclear cardiology, adult echocardiography, and internal medicine. He completed his cardiology fellowship at UCLA and his internal medicine training at UT Southwestern. He also received his medical degree from UT Southwestern, where he started medical school at age 19.
Dr. Cho speaks English, Japanese and Mandarin. Dr. Cho's current research focuses on cardiac imaging and artificial intelligence in cardiac computed tomography. He has published in multiple journals, including Circulation, Circulation Research, JACC, Science, BBA, CMI, and PNAS. He has also won several prestigious accolades, including being an American College of Cardiology Young Investigator Award Finalist, Northwestern Cardiovascular Young Investigators Competition Finalist, and American Heart Association Southwest-Affiliate Fellowship Grant Award recipient. He also has been elected as a Fellow of the American Heart Association (FAHA) and American College of Cardiology (FACC) and also an American College of Cardiology (ACC) Young Investigator Award Committee Member.
